How much does it cost to rent a home in Bristol Heights?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Bristol Heights 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,704 | $1,200 | $2,405 |
| Bristol Heights 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,290 | $1,690 | $3,900 |
| Bristol Heights 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,895 | $1,900 | $9,000 |
| Bristol Heights 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,470 | $2,200 | $7,400 |
| Bristol Heights 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$8,283 | $3,100 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Bristol Heights
What type of rentals are currently available in Bristol Heights?
There are currently 37 Apartments for Rent in Bristol Heights, NV with pricing that ranges from $1,229 to $4,494. There are also 196 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Bristol Heights ranging from $1,200 to $13,750.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Bristol Heights?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Bristol Heights ranges from $1,200 to $13,750 with an average monthly rent of $3,408.
